gtk-config... ERROR
rootkit 11 декабря, 2006 - 20:02
checking for gtk-config... no
checking for GTK - version >= 1.2.2... no
*** The gtk-config script installed by GTK could not be found
*** If GTK was installed in PREFIX, make sure PREFIX/bin is in
*** your path, or set the GTK_CONFIG environment variable to the
*** full path to gtk-config.
configure: error: *** GTK+ >= 1.2.2 not installed - please install first ***
Please help! I cant install xmms player! But gtk+ is surceffuly installed on my system...
»
- Для комментирования войдите или зарегистрируйтесь
Так егоже,
Так егоже, по-моему, уже удалили из дерева портежей. Переходите на что-нибудь другое, или покажите последние несколько страниц configure.log.
Последние
Последние несколько страниц? Я не знаю почему не могу поставить xmms player... Пишет после ./configure
checking for GLIB - version >= 1.2.2... yes
checking for gtk-config... no
checking for GTK - version >= 1.2.2... no
*** The gtk-config script installed by GTK could not be found
*** If GTK was installed in PREFIX, make sure PREFIX/bin is in
*** your path, or set the GTK_CONFIG environment variable to the
*** full path to gtk-config.
configure: error: *** GTK+ >= 1.2.2 not installed - please install first ***
В чём может быть дело?
Поставил кодеки вот так - emerge win32codecs, скажите этого хватает для воспроизведения видео? При попытке проиграть видео через mplayer, видео то запускается, а вот картинки нет и вот что вижу:
localhost Video # mplayer -fs negants_-_The_Fairy-Tale.wmv
MPlayer 1.0pre8-4.1.1 (C) 2000-2006 MPlayer Team
CPU: Intel(R) Pentium(R) 4 CPU 2.40GHz (Family: 15, Model: 3, Stepping: 3)
MMX supported but disabled
MMX2 supported but disabled
SSE supported but disabled
SSE2 supported but disabled
CPUflags: MMX: 0 MMX2: 0 3DNow: 0 3DNow2: 0 SSE: 0 SSE2: 0
Compiled for x86 CPU with extensions:
Playing negants_-_The_Fairy-Tale.wmv..
ASF file format detected.
VIDEO: [WMV3] 800x600 24bpp 1000.000 fps 0.0 kbps ( 0.0 kbyte/s)
Clip info:
name: negants - The Fairy-Tale
author: krX
copyright: krXDesign
comments: #krXDesign ; #negants.cs @ enio.irc.lv
==========================================================================
Opening audio decoder: [ffmpeg] FFmpeg/libavcodec audio decoders
AUDIO: 44100 Hz, 2 ch, s16le, 44.4 kbit/3.15% (ratio: 5552->176400)
Selected audio codec: [ffwmav2] afm: ffmpeg (DivX audio v2 (FFmpeg))
==========================================================================
vo_cvidix: No vidix driver name provided, probing available ones (-v option for details)!
[nvidia_vid] Found chip: NV17 [GeForce4 MX440]
libdha: DHA kernelhelper failed: No such file or directory
[nvidia_vid] arch 10 register base 0xb6f1b000
libdha: DHA kernelhelper failed: No such file or directory
[nvidia_vid] detected memory size 64 MB
[nvidia_vid] MTRR set up
[nvidia_vid] video mode: 1024x768@32
[VO_SUB_VIDIX] Description: NVIDIA RIVA OVERLAY DRIVER.
[VO_SUB_VIDIX] Author: Sascha Sommer
==========================================================================
Requested video codec family [wmv9dmo] (vfm=dmo) not available.
Enable it at compilation.
Requested video codec family [wmvdmo] (vfm=dmo) not available.
Enable it at compilation.
Cannot find codec matching selected -vo and video format 0x33564D57.
Read DOCS/HTML/en/codecs.html!
==========================================================================
alsa-init: using device default
alsa: 48000 Hz/2 channels/4 bpf/65536 bytes buffer/Signed 16 bit Little Endian
AO: [alsa] 48000Hz 2ch s16le (2 bytes per sample)
Video: no video
Starting playback...
Люди, помогите пожалста разобраться, если я вдруг что не указал, то скажиье с какого лога взять инфу, если это вам поможет..._________________
xmms не можешь
xmms не можешь поставить по той простой причине, что из портэджей его удалили со всеми потрохами.
С mplayer'ом... Может попробовать его пересобрать? Всё равно придётся, т.к. у тебя поддерживаются флаги mmx,sse,mmx2,sse2, но при сборке не были указаны.
Попробуй ещё повыбирать mplayer -vo <что-нибудь из списка mplayer -vo help>
Может ещё
Может ещё какие-то флаги не включены. Почитай здесь.
Получается что
Получается что мх плеера теперь не будет? Тогда можно удалить и ГТК+? А как правильно это сделать, чтобы ничего связанного с ним не осталось... И подскажите как поставить кодеки, чтобы в системе был звук?
_________________
А он глючный
А он глючный был. Хотя кому как нравилось. Юзай amarok или audacious.
А какое отношение кодеки имеют к звуку? По-моему, никакого.
Удалить ГТК+, конечно, можно, но зачем? Завиcимостей у него много. Посмотреть их, кстати, можно equery d gtk+
А глюк вот этот
А глюк вот этот нужно вообще исправлять, всмысле с конфигом ГТК+ при компиляции плеера? У меня же он не стоял (ГТК+) до этого, ну вот предположим проблем нету пока с ним, если я пишу команду - emerge gtk+, я могу быть уверен что автоматически установятся все самые новые пакеты? И кстати вот эти настройки правильные? - CFLAGS="-O3 -marc=pentium4 -pipe"? или надо наоборот - CFLAGS="-marc=pentium4 -pipe -O3"
_________________
Порядок
Порядок значения не имеет (кстати, не marc, а march). Ну и O3 я бы не рекомендовал -- сильно увеличивает время компиляции, а выигрыш по сравнению с O2 очень небольшой.
Если при установке пакета возникли ошибки, то можно не бояться, что где-то остался мусор и тд, тк сборка осуществляется в темпе, а только после успешной установки всё копируется в нужные директории.
А чтобы гарантировано контролировать то, что ставится, используй вместо просто emerge дополнительные ключи emerge -qav
А возможно ли
А возможно ли после команд emerge any programm, даже если установка шла с ошибками, что программа установлена нормально, ведь я полагаю что если установка была неудачной, то ошибки будут описаны вконце?_________________
После
После критических ошибок сборка программы прекращается. В конце пишется обычно только резюме ошибки, а что произошло конкретно, надо смотреть в логах. В Вашем случае в /var/tmp/portage/.../work/.../configure.log